The City of El Paso Environmental Services Department (ESD) reminds customers that changes to curbside recycling collection schedules start this week on Tuesday, March 31, 2020.

The public may check their recycling collection schedules online or via the free ESD Works for You app. All customers were notified of their new schedules through notices mailed to their homes earlier month.

Curbside Recycling Program Background

When the blue bins were first distributed in 2007, the program lacked a mechanism for tracking the rate at which customers set out their bins and other vital metrics for evaluating the effectiveness of the program. As a result, recycling collection trucks have been running routes where less than half of the bins are set out for collection, and the majority of those containers placed on the curb are less than a quarter full.

Recycling collections are shifting to every other week collections as recently acquired data shows more than half of customers consistently choose to not place their blue bins out on a weekly basis. Customers will see improved on-time recycling collections through the new operational efficiencies, less wear and tear on streets, and expanded solid waste services through the reallocations of savings resulting from these changes.
